Rufus
Rufus is a single, red & white, neutered male looking for his forever home. He is 2 1/2 years old and would love a house with another younger playful pup though he is happy simply playing with toys by himself as well. Rufus has gotten along well in a house with a large cat; however, he is overly interested in what the cats leave inside the litter box, so you will need to ensure the litter box is not accessible by him. Rufus really likes little kids but could knock them over as he is so interested in them. Rufus love walks, car rides and playing fetch or chase in the yard. While Rufus has a lot of play energy he also enjoys spending time on the couch just relaxing with a bone or taking a nap. He is very curious and determined and will get through small spaces just to see what's on the other side which means he needs a secure fenced yard. He also enjoys "counter surfing" for anything and everything. He is house-trained and has occasional accidents although he has improved while in his foster home. Rufus is crate-trained, and he has no food, treat, or toy aggression. Rufus is a very good boy overall, and he is working on his manners. He is a classic, stubborn basset hound, so he listens when he feels like it.

Turner
Turner has visited a BHRG vet for a complete check up and is ready for adoption. He's a tri-colored boy who is around 5 1/2 years old and gets along with kids and other dogs. He rides well in a car, and enjoys walks although he does pull a bit on the leash. Turner is sweet and loving, but he can be a stinker at times and get into things that he shouldn't. Ziplock bags fascinate him, and he will get anything within reach like a loaf of bread, etc. But you can't get mad at him because he is so sweet. He is a good sleeper during the day, and he sleeps in his crate at night. Turner is dealing with skin allergies and is eating special food and taking medication. He will most likely always have skin/allergy issues, but the vet is helping him be as comfortable as possible. Turner is dog door trained and crate trained.
